Marana is part of the Tucson, AZ metro area (BLS area code 46060). Where MSA-level wages are published, the table below shows MSA medians; otherwise it falls back to Arizona statewide.
| Occupation | Median Wage | Source | COL-Adjusted (US=100)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Civil Engineer | $75,900 | Tucson, AZ | $78,328 |
| Electrical Engineer | $110,510 | Tucson, AZ | $114,045 |
| Mechanical Engineer | $110,730 | Tucson, AZ | $114,272 |
| Chemical Engineer | $125,050 | AZ statewide | $129,051 |
| Aerospace Engineer | $111,490 | Tucson, AZ | $115,057 |
| Biomedical Engineer | $102,110 | Tucson, AZ | $105,377 |
| Environmental Engineer | $82,120 | Tucson, AZ | $84,747 |
| Architectural and Engineering Manager | $179,760 | Tucson, AZ | $185,511 |
Source: BLS, May 2024 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ics publishes wage data at the metro (MSA) and state level – not by individual city.
